92 CIM_LogicalElement
CIM_ExtraCapacityGroup
The CIM_ExtraCapacityGroup class explained in Table 3-44 applies to systems
that have more capability and components than are required for normal
operation, for example, systems that have extra fans or power supplies.
Table 3-43. CIM_RedundancyGroup Properties
Class Name: CIM_RedundancyGroup
Parent Class: CIM_LogicalElement
Property Description Data
Typ e
CreationClassName See Table 1-1 string
Name Serves as the key for the redundancy group’s
instance in an enterprise environment.
string
RedundancyStatus Provides information on the state of the redundancy
group. Values for the RedundancyStatus property
are as follows:
0 - Unknown
1 - Other
2 - Fully redundant. Fully redundant means that all of the
configured redundancy is still available.
3 - Degraded redundancy. Degraded redundancy means
that some failures have been experienced but some
reduced amount of redundancy is still available.
4 - Redundancy lost. Redundancy lost means that a
sufficient number of failures have occurred so that no
redundancy is available and the next failure experienced
will cause overall failure.
uint16
